1. Futurepedia
Futurepedia is recognized as the largest AI tool directory, boasting an impressive collection of over 5,000 tools. One of its standout features is the "Tools Added Today" section, which allows users to see the latest additions on specific dates. The website is regularly updated with the newest AI news and offers various sorting options such as verified, new, or popular tools. Each category displays the number of tools available, and a personal favorite is the trending AI tools section, which highlights the most popular tools daily.
Futurepedia also includes a chat function that helps you search for specific tools. For instance, if you're looking for the best deals on flights, simply enter your request, and multiple options will be presented. Each tool is linked to a detailed page that explains its features, alternatives, and even offers fantastic deals and discounts. Additionally, Futurepedia provides a list of upcoming AI conferences globally, complete with dates, locations, and pricing details.
2. AI Encyclopedia
Hosting a collection of over 3,000 AI tools, prompts, and podcasts, AI Encyclopedia offers a user-friendly interface with easy navigation. Categories like tools (paid or free), podcasts, and more are conveniently placed on the left column. The top bar features categories such as video generators, video editing, transcribers, and text-to-speech tools.
When exploring a category like text-to-speech, clicking on it reveals a comprehensive list of available tools, each with a detailed description and a link to their respective websites.
3. There’s An AI For That
This directory features a vast collection of over 9,000 tools across different categories. It provides lists of recently launched tools, featured tools, and saved tools based on user suggestions. Each category is broken down to show the number of tools available and highlights the latest additions.
The built-in chat function is particularly useful. For example, if you’re looking for SEO tools, type your request, and it will quickly generate a list of available options for you to explore.
4. AI Tool Directory
With more than 25 categories, AI Tool Directory stands out with its "Collections" section. This curated list showcases top AI tools necessary for specific fields, such as podcasting, along with explanations as to why each tool is essential.
Additionally, users can check the "Top 100 AI Tools" section, which can be sorted based on recent additions, ratings, or favorites. The newsletter sign-up option helps keep users informed about the latest happenings in AI.
5. Future Tools
Founded by Matt Wolf, Future Tools offers an impressive assortment of AI tools within more than 20 categories. The site features Matt's picks and special offers, making it an excellent resource for AI enthusiasts.
For instance, if you're interested in AI text-to-speech tools, you can easily select the category to access a list of tools that provide detailed descriptions, pricing information, and links to their websites.
